Analog circuits are circuits that deal with varying voltages, for example things like dimmers, audio circuits, and much much more. Digital circuits are more what we're used to from programming, where wires can carry a voltage / logical '1' or no voltage / logical '0'. You can create logic circuits out of simple AND, OR, XOR, etc gates, 555 timers, and the like, or you can program PLDs or microcontrollers. At the far end of removing most of the electrical engineering portion of the equation, there are platforms like the Arduino.
